If you are bouncing stems to send to a mastering engineer, client, or for archive purposes, I recommend bouncing down your tracks in the  “Gang of four” approach, suggested by Mastering Engineer Bob Katz. It will allow for flexibility where it is needed.

Create four stems, as follows:

Stem #1. TV (that’s instrumental plus chorus or background vocals).
Stem #2. Lead Vocal(s) (plus its reverb of course —basically muting everything else).
Stem #3. Full Mix (that’s what I will use unless there is a problem, and it’s also a reference to prove that #1 and #2 were made correctly).
Stem #4. Instrumental – All Instruments only (by adding this to #1 we can reduce the chorus level. By subtracting this from #1 we can increase the chorus level. By subtracting this from #3 we can increase lead and chorus. And so on! – Bob Katz
